Hi all,
I am running WinXP Pro & MS Outlook 2000 on home network workgroup
configured as Corporate & Workgroup. I leave Outlook running all the
time minimized in the taskbar. I was wondering if anyone knows a way
(either within Outlook, Windows or using an Add On) to make Outlook
open a new email message in a window when the message is received? I
have seen other types of programs (for example there is a phone
answering machine program) that opens a new window on each call and
cascades them across the screen. I would like that to happen with
Outlook if possible.
 
M

Milly Staples [MVP - Outlook]

Not possible natively in Outlook 2000 - try for a third party notification
program. There are many out there.
